Random Number Generators (RNGs)
The backbone of most online casino games is the Random Number Generator (RNG). RNGs are computer algorithms that generate random outcomes for games. This technology ensures that the results of games, such as slots, blackjack, and roulette, are fair and unpredictable. When a player spins a slot machine, the RNG will determine the result in a fraction of a second, ensuring that each spin is independent of the last.

Game Rules and Structure



Each type of online casino game comes with its own set of rules and mechanics. For instance, in slot games, players must match symbols across pay lines to win prizes, while poker requires strategy, skill, and knowledge of the game’s hierarchy. Online blackjack players aim to beat the dealer by achieving a hand value closest to 21 without exceeding it. Understanding the rules of each game is crucial for any player aiming to succeed.
Betting Strategies
Many players develop betting strategies to improve their chances of winning. Strategies vary widely, from progressive betting systems to flat betting. In games like roulette, players might employ the Martingale system, which involves doubling bets after each loss to recoup losses. Blackjack players often use basic strategy charts, which guide them on when to hit, stand, or double down based on the dealer’s visible card.
The House Edge
Every casino game has a built-in advantage for the house, often referred to as the “house edge.” This percentage reflects the average gross profit the casino can expect to make from players over time. For instance, the house edge in roulette varies depending on the type of bet, while slots typically have a higher house edge, often ranging from 2% to 10%. Understanding the house edge helps players make informed decisions about their gameplay.
Live Dealer Games
As technology advances, many online casinos now offer live dealer games, bringing the brick-and-mortar experience directly to players’ screens. In live dealer games, players interact with real dealers through video streaming. This adds an element of realism and social interaction, which is often lacking in traditional online games. Players can partake in games like live blackjack, baccarat, and roulette, enjoying the thrill of a physical casino atmosphere.
